The Vargem das Flores basin in the municipality of Contagem/mg is the scene of intense conflicts related to land use and divergent policies on territorial planning and environmental protection, because the area is protected by environmental legislation. Downstream of the basin there is a dam for the formation of the Vargem das Flores reservoir that supplies the urban population of the Belo Horizonte Metropolitan Region. The prevalence of municipal interests over metropolitan interests put the remaining green areas, watercourses, and drainage channels at risk due to the possibility of urban expansion in the area. In this context, this study sought to map the possibility of reconciling urban expansion and environmental conservation in Vargem das Flores and to identify possible conflicts of interest in the basin. The multi-criteria analysis method was used, and it resulted in three syntheses: urban expansion, environmental conservation, and integration synthesis. After building the syntheses, an alternative approach was built to identify land use skills based on the master plan, which resulted in a mapping that sought to meet the needs identified in the territory. The results revealed that the proposed zoning in 2018 puts at risk natural resources fundamental to the existence of the reservoir. The aptitude synthesis adapted to the plan presented an alternative that reconciles the existing conflicting interests.
